Hedgehogs Productions is a site where I stick all my cartoons and the like on. They essentially came from doodles and what have you from my school days, but gradually I became more ambitious. Instead of just drawing in my exercise books, I put cartoons on my flat door. Then even more ambitious, I built a website, and started to do a proper series, Hedgehogs. From that grew Factory, based on my experiences in, well and factory. It's still the cartoon I value most, but I have since moved back to hedgehogs in Hejhox, because it looks nicer.

Elsewhere, I exercise my juices (creative) on violence and randomness with Fred East and WTF.

Pointless trivia: As the version number strongly implies, this is incarnation five of Hedgehogs websites. The first two are so poor I can't remember them. I recall them both being entirely hand coded in notepad. The first had a couple images, (a logo, maybe another) and the other was a lot more complex with a proper menubar with mouseover images, and an intricate cast image which lit up characters with a mouseover. Since, I have used Dreamweaver and the presentation of my websites has improved dramatically. I'd probably be better off, learning-wise if I did a lot more coding, but I'm lazy.
